
Danny Rose has sat out of Newcastle United training with injury, according to the Daily Star.
Rose raised his concerns about Newcastle returning to training earlier this month, but Steve Bruce has spoken to the defender about his concerns.
Rose is now thought to be prepared to come back to Newcastle training, but he has been unable to so far.
The Tottenham Hotspur loanee has been suffering with a sore calf, which he has picked up during lockdown.

Thankfully for Rose the issue is not thought to be a serious one, and he should join his Newcastle teammates later this week.
That is good news for Newcastle, as Rose has been a key player since his arrival.
Bruce has only spoken positively about the England international, who has quickly become Newcastle’s first-choice at left-back.
